Vauxhall Inn
"The Vauxhall Inn is a beautiful, cosy country pub nestled in Tonbridge and we’re so proud to welcome you. Enjoy quality time with your friends and family, try delicious drinks from our expertly curated menu and sample our tasty pub food. Whether it's a hot drink to warm you up after a rainy walk or a catch up with friends over a glass or two of fizz , our welcoming team will ensure these are moments spent well. Vauxhall Inn is the perfect place to unwind in a warm, cosy pub environment and the promise you will be looked after with effortless quality and timeless tradition."

A chain pub, so you would never get anything unique, but as chain pubs go this was excellent. Friendly staff, and the food was cooked to perfection. Convenient location by the A21 and a large car park behind the pub, just make sure you put your registration into the tablet by the entrance to make sure you don't get a ticket.
